MetaMask转出代币失败的解决方案与解析
在加密货币和去中心化金融(DeFi)快速发展的今天,MetaMask作为一种流行的数字钱包,吸引了无数用户。然而,用户在进行代币转出时,可能会遇到各种问题,其中“转出代币失败”是最常见的一种。本文将深入探讨该问题的根源,提供解决方案,并针对相关问题进行详细分析,以帮助用户更好地使用MetaMask进行代币转出。
转出代币失败的常见原因是什么?
MetaMask转出代币失败可能由多个因素导致,了解这些原因能够有效帮助用户诊断问题,尽快找到解决方案。
一、网络问题
在使用MetaMask时,网络连接的稳定性至关重要。如果用户在转出代币时网络不稳定,可能会导致交易无法成功提交或确认。此外,如果用户选择的网络拥堵严重,也会影响交易的处理速度,导致交易失败。
二、Gas费用不足
在以太坊网络中,每笔交易都需要支付Gas费用。Gas费用的多少取决于网络的拥堵程度及用户设置的上限。如果用户设置的Gas费用过低,交易可能会被矿工忽视,从而导致转出失败。
三、合约问题
一些代币在转出时需要通过智能合约进行操作,如果合约本身存在问题,或者未得到足够的批准(比如 ERC-20 代币的转出通常需要调用 `approve` 方法),也可能导致交易失败。
四、账户余额不足
显而易见,如果用户的账户余额不足以覆盖转出的代币数量以及相关的Gas费用,系统将会阻止交易,因此确保账户余额充足是非常重要的。
五、MetaMask配置错误
MetaMask的配置(如网络选择、代币添加等)可能导致转出失败。如果用户未正确选择目标网络,或者未成功添加代币合约信息,都会造成操作错误。
如何查看和调整Gas费用?
Gas费用是以太坊网络中交易的重要组成部分,合理的Gas策略可以大大提高交易的成功率。
一、查看推荐的Gas费用
用户在MetaMask中转出代币时,系统会给出当前网络的建议Gas费用(通常是在交易确认页面)。用户可以根据推荐的Gas费用进行设置,避免因设置过低导致交易失败。
二、手动调整Gas费用
如果用户遇到交易拥堵,或者希望快速完成交易,可以点击“编辑”按钮来手动调整Gas费用。MetaMask允许用户根据个人需求,上调Gas费用以加速交易处理。
三、使用第三方工具
有许多网站和工具(如Gas Station Network)提供了实时的Gas费用查询功能,用户可以根据这些数据来调整MetaMask中的Gas费用。这些工具往往提供了不同网络状态下的最佳Gas费用建议,可以帮助用户更直观地进行选择。
四、考虑使用“速度优先”或“经济型”设置
MetaMask还提供了“速度优先”和“经济型”等选项,用户可以根据自身情况选择合适的策略。选择“速度优先”会自动设置较高的Gas费用以确保快速交易,而“经济型”则尝试以较低的费用执行交易,但相对来说风险较高。
转出失败后如何进行补救?
如果用户在MetaMask中遇到转出失败的问题,及时采取补救措施至关重要。
一、检查交易状态
首先,用户应该在MetaMask的交易历史中查看失败交易的状态,确认交易失败的原因。MetaMask通常会提供交易失败的错误信息,有助于确定问题所在。
二、调整参数重新提交
用户可以根据之前检查到的原因,适当调整Gas费用、网络设置等,然后重新提交交易。例如,如果是因为Gas费用不足导致失败,那么可以适当增加Gas的上限,然后再进行转出尝试。
三、联系项目方或技术支持
如果用户不确定失败的原因,或者在尝试了各种自助方式仍无法解决问题,可以考虑联系相关代币的项目方或MetaMask的技术支持。他们可能会给出更专业的建议,帮助用户解决问题。
四、备份与保管好私钥及助记词
在处理任何钱包相关问题时,确保用户的私钥和助记词得到妥善的备份和保管。尤其是在尝试较复杂的技术方案时,避免因操作失误导致资金损失。
如何避免未来的转出失败?
为了减少MetaMask转出代币失败的次数,用户可以采取多种预防措施。
一、充分了解网络环境
用户应该关注以太坊网络的状态,以便在网络拥堵时选择合适的交易时机。了解市场上高峰时段,可以有效减少拥堵带来的风险。
二、设置适当的Gas费用
用户在进行任何交易前,务必查看当前网络的Gas费用,并根据建议进行设置。如果交易不够着急,也可以选择较低的Gas费用,只是要留意可能的等待时间。
三、维护好MetaMask的设置与安全
用户要定期检查MetaMask的设置,包括账户余额和代币信息,确保信息的准确性。同时,保管好助记词和私钥,避免因安全问题导致的账户丢失。
四、学习更多的操作知识
投资者的知识储备越充分,操作过程中就越能避开潜在的风险。用户可以通过访问官方网站、参与相关社区、观看视频教程等多种途径,增强对MetaMask与代币转出流程的理解与掌握。
综上所述,MetaMask转出代币失败的问题并非不可解决,通过了解其原因、妥善设定Gas费用、进行及时的补救及采用有效的预防措施,用户可以极大程度地降低此类问题的出现,确保数字资产的安全与流通。